University of Alabama rules regarding firearms, and I believe all universities in state have similar, only allow " for a firearm properly maintained in a personal vehicle in a manner consistent with Alabama law", otherwise NO,

I didnāt attend college I was visiting Fayetteville and found myself accidentally on campus with a concealed handgun. After that I reached out and got the information I needed. This isnāt legal advice but I was told that so long as it stayed in the car it was legal but I needed an Arkansas enhanced carry permit to walk around campus with it. Then there are some administrative and sporting event buildings that further regulate firearms
